 Minang Food & Fashion Fest 2024

The Malaysia Tourism Agency Association (MATA), in collaboration with the Indonesia Halal Lifestyle Center, is organizing the International Minang Food & Fashion Festival 2024. This groundbreaking event, set to redefine cultural and gastronomic tourism, will take place from August 23rd to 26th at the Sunway Resort Hotel in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ia.

The festival coincides with the Asia Islamic Tourism & Trade Expo (AITEX 2024) and highlights the strong cultural and economic ties between Malaysia and Indonesia, particularly in the halal industry sector.

A Culinary and Fashion Journey

Themed “Celebrating Halal Culinary Heritage,” this festival invites guests on a sensory exploration of Minang cuisine and the beauty of modest fashion. Attendees can expect a variety of activities that delve into the richness of Minang culture. From the Modest Fashion Show featuring innovative designs inspired by traditional Minang attire to performances by Vanny Vabiola, known as the Minang’s “Celine Dion,” the festival celebrates cultural pride and creativity.

Culinary Heritage at the Forefront

The Minang International Food Festival, a highlight of the event, is more than just a showcase of Minangkabau’s culinary excellence; it is an exploration of the intricate flavors and cooking techniques that define this cuisine. Attendees will have the chance to savor dishes like the internationally acclaimed Rendang and the aromatic Nasi Padang, along with a variety of other delectable offerings that illustrate the depth of Minang culinary artistry.

Dr. Sapta Nirwandar, Chairman of the Indonesia Halal Lifestyle Center, and Dato Dr. Mohd Khalid, have both underscored the festival’s role in enhancing gastronomy tourism and promoting cultural exchange. Through culinary demonstrations, cultural performances, and interactive sessions, the festival aims to deepen visitors’ appreciation for Minangkabau’s rich culinary and cultural heritage.
